The GenomeTrakr network is the first distributed network of laboratories to utilize whole genome sequencing for pathogen identification. It consists of public health and ...
WebApproximately 185 million to ns of food loss and waste is generated in North America annually. This estimate encompasses all stages of the food supply chain, including the pre-harvest and consumer stages. 2. Figure 1. Estimates of Food Loss and Waste (FLW) across the Food Supply Chain in North America2.
